I want to make a vector with the third column of a matrix, but only for the
2+3n rows of the matrix, with n being an entire number from 0 to a million.
How can I do that in an easy way?

Example:
n - 1:10
mat[2+3*n,3] #Where mat is the matrix
Is what you want?
